    Steel Cans Global Market Outlook

    • The global tinplate can market is expected to grow at 3–4 percent CAGR during 2023E–2027F, to reach ~$31 billion, driven by rising consumption of canned foods and change in consumer purchasing behavior

    • Growth is expected to be gradual, as the impact of COVID-19 has had a major impact on sales, demand, and supply of canned food and tinplate cans across the globe

    Supply Base for Steel Cans

    • The supply base for tinplate cans is consolidated with the top four firms accounting for about 65 percent of the market share in H1 2023

    • Production capacities of the global firms are concentrated in the Europe and North American markets, where penetration of tinplate cans in the packaged food segment is high

    • New expansions by can makers, such as Crown & Silgan, have been planned for Eastern Europe and Middle East markets over the next two years, to cater to demand from these regions

    Global Market Size: Steel Cans

    • Growing number of individual consumers would drive the demand for smaller can sizes and reclosable containers that favor on-the-go consumption of packaged foods

    • Converters have been investing to reduce overall cost of cans through design innovations to reduce surface area and weight, to minimize the cost difference between plastic and metal containers

    • Global demand for food metal cans is expected to grow at about 3.5–4.5 percent CAGR, as a result of increasing penetration of metal containers in food and beverage segments of the emerging markets in APAC and LATAM

    • Preservative properties and higher shelf-life offered by metal food cans compared to plastic and paper-based packaging solutions have led to increased preference in the market. The high recyclability of metal packaging has also strengthened its position in the market

    • Increasing demand for smaller size packs and multi-packs is driving volume demand in the developed markets of North America and Europe, while also driving up the unit cost of containers

    • The global supply base for metal cans is dominated by few large suppliers, such as Silgan, Ball, and Crown Holdings, accounting for major market share, with a few medium to small local players competing for the market, especially in the emerging markets

    Industry Drivers and Constraints : Steel Cans

    Drivers

    Growing Awareness About Sustainability and Reusability of Metal Cans

    • Metal cans are highly recyclable compared to plastic and glass containers

    • About 70 percent of the metal cans manufactured come from recycled content, which also highly decreases the conversion cost of the containers

    Supply Availability

    • There is very less risk of supply availability of tinplate raw materials, due to the demand for varied end-use sectors

    • Also, owing to the large availability of recyclable materials, there is no shortage of tinplate can materials

    Preservative Properties and Higher Shelf-Life

    • Metal cans, especially ones made from tinplate, offer high preservative properties and shelf-life, while having low toxicity, high corrosion resistance, and production efficiency. These properties make it highly favorable for food containers

    Constraints

    Threat from Alternative Packaging Solutions, like Paper and Plastic Packaging

    • Metal cans have faced substitution threat from many new innovative paper and flexible plastic packaging concepts that improve their sustainability, while providing similar barrier properties as metal containers

    Uncertainty in Raw Material Prices

    • Steel prices have fluctuated widely in the last two years, owing to supply–demand dynamics, which has affected tinplate can prices
